**About the Role**
As a Supply Chain Planner, you will evaluate demand signals from multiple sources and translate them into efficient, customer-focused production schedules. You'll collaborate cross-functionally with Production Planning, Site Operations, Manufacturing, Order Management, Sales, Marketing, and Distribution teams to ensure alignment between customer demand and operational capacity.
This role also includes responsibility for maintaining accurate data and schedules in SAP, supporting multiple product types, and ensuring seamless scheduling coverage across the business.
**Key Responsibilities**
+ Analyze demand signals and develop production schedules that balance customer requirements, lead times, inventory targets, and production efficiency.
+ Partner with planners, production, procurement, customer service, and management to prioritize and adjust schedules as needed.
+ Identify and resolve material and supplier challenges; optimize lead times and develop replenishment strategies to reduce working capital.
+ Collaborate with maintenance, quality, and operations to minimize downtime and support preventive maintenance initiatives (TPM).
+ Support inventory management activities, including physical counts and SOX-compliant documentation.
+ Promote a culture of safety by leading or supporting safety initiatives, audits, and compliance training.
+ Drive quality performance through a "right first time" mindset, process audits, and root cause analysis when issues arise.
+ Lead or support cross-functional improvement projects to optimize scheduling, material flow, and equipment efficiency.
+ Provide material forecasts to suppliers and manage product lifecycle activities such as phase-ins, promotions, and discontinuations.
+ Communicate supply or service issues to Procurement and coordinate resolution.
+ Foster collaboration with supplier partners to meet dynamic production and customer needs.

What you'll do on a typical day:

  • Participate in the Lean warehousing system
  • Perform filing and reporting duties
  • Use Warehouse Management System (WMS) technology for wave planning
  • Review associated logistics documentation, including Advanced Shipping Notice (ASN), Bill of Lading (BOL) and Shipper's Letter of Instruction (SLI)
What you need to succeed at GXO:

At a minimum, you'll need:

  • 1 year of logistics experience
  • Basic Microsoft Office skills
  • Working knowledge of a WMS
  • Knowledge of ASNs, BOLs and SLIs

Take lead in in deploying the Lean Principles at site level through the basic tools that Lean Six Sigma methodology offers. The Site Green Belt is the key representative of Continuous Improvement culture that every site needs to embrace. Located in Rialto, CA.
**How you create impact**
+ Lead Kaizens and GB projects
+ Support and co-implement 5S, visual management, work instructions and other Production System standards
+ Co-lead 5S audits
+ Support Yellow Belts
+ Deliver Yellow Belt/White Belt/Production System induction training
+ Support and co-facilitate Deep Dive Value Stream Analysis events and other Lean events (Kaizen, VSM)
+ Implement idea management (Suggestion Management)
+ Support daily performance management and project follow-up
+ Facilitate site teams delivering Production System targets
+ Update Continious Improvement tracker, continuous improvement activity
+ Make business cases for Innovations
+ Take actions to upgrade site Excellence levels
+ Secure Productivity Management usage and run productivity initiatives
+ Contribute to client presentations
